2N,N')cobalt(II)] dimethylformamide disolvateAbstract: The asymmetric unit of the title compound, [Co2(C10H2O4S3)2(C12H8N2)4]·2C3H7NO, contains one half of the formula unit, with the rest generated by inversion. The cobalt ion sits in a slightly distorted octahedral environment and is ligated to four N atoms of two 1,10-phenanthroline molecules and to two O atoms of two dithieno[3,2-b:2',3'-d]thiophene-2,6-dicarboxylate anions. The anions act as bridges between the CoII centers.
